DVD: www.amazon.com thefilmarchived.blogspot.com The Terror of Tiny Town is a 1938 American film produced by Jed Buell, directed by Sam Newfield, and starring Billy Curtis. It is the world's only musical Western with an all-midget cast. Using a conventional Western story with an all midget cast, the filmmakers were able to showcase gags such as cowboys entering the local saloon by walking under the swinging doors, and pint-sized cowboys galloping around on Shetland ponies while roping calves. The plot is about a cowboy helping out a beautiful ranch owner menaced by local thugs. O'Docharty as The Old Soak The film presents Jed Buell's Midgets. Many of them were also in the performing troupe, Singer's Midgets, and played Munchkins in The Wizard of Oz, released in 1939. In 1986, the movie was featured in an episode of the Canned Film Festival. Billy Curtis (June 27, 1909 - November 9, 1988) was an American film and television actor.
